Impact-resistant PC board extrusion molding device
Technical Field
The utility model relates to a PC board production technical field especially relates to an impact-resistant PC board extrusion moulding device.
Background
The PC board is engineering plastic with excellent comprehensive performance and is a common material in building boards; the existing PC board extrusion molding device can extrude raw materials into boards with the same size and shape; the length and the width of the plate can not be adjusted at any time according to the needs in the production of the prior art, particles can be generated in the hot melting process, and no protective measures are needed; an impact-resistant PC board extrusion molding device is designed to solve the problems in the prior art.

In order to achieve the above purpose, the utility model adopts the following technical scheme:
an impact-resistant PC board extrusion molding device comprises a support plate, wherein the upper surface of the support plate is fixedly connected with a flow guide pipe, one end of the flow guide pipe is provided with a through hole, the inside of the through hole is rotatably connected with a screw rod, one end of the screw rod is fixedly connected with a first motor, the outer surface of the flow guide pipe is fixedly connected with a flow guide box, the top of the flow guide box is fixedly connected with a hot melting box, the bottom of the hot melting box is fixedly connected with a filter screen, the inner wall of the hot melting box is rotatably connected with a stirring column, one end of the stirring column is fixedly connected with a second motor, the lower surface of the flow guide pipe is fixedly connected with a discharge hole, the bottom of the discharge hole is provided with a chute, the inside of the chute is slidably connected with a sliding plate, one side of the support, one end of the telescopic plate is fixedly connected with a cutting blade.
Preferably, the impact-resistant PC board extrusion molding device is characterized in that the lower surface of the supporting rod is fixedly connected with a supporting column, and a round hole is formed in the supporting column.
Preferably, the inside fixedly connected with bearing of round hole, the inside rotation of bearing is connected with the rotation post.
Preferably, the outer surface of the rotating column is connected with a conveyor belt in a conveying mode, and the outer surface of the conveyor belt is provided with an anti-slip groove.
Preferably, one side fixedly connected with slip table of backup pad, the upper surface sliding connection of slip table has the guard gate.
Preferably, the outer surface of the protective door is provided with a window, and the inside of the window is fixedly connected with transparent glass.

Referring to fig. 1-4, an impact-resistant PC board extrusion molding apparatus comprises a support plate 1, a sliding table fixedly connected to one side of the support plate 1, a protective door 20 slidably connected to the upper surface of the sliding table, and a sliding protective door 20 movable on the sliding table to open or close the apparatus, thereby achieving a certain protective effect, a window is formed on the outer surface of the protective door 20, a transparent glass 21 is fixedly connected to the inside of the window, a guide pipe 2 is fixedly connected to the upper surface of the support plate 1, a through hole is formed at one end of the guide pipe 2, a screw rod 3 is rotatably connected to the inside of the through hole, a first motor 4 is fixedly connected to one end of the screw rod 3, a guide box 5 is fixedly connected to the outer surface of the guide pipe 2, a hot melting box 6 is fixedly connected to the top of the guide box 5, a filter screen 7 is, thereby preventing the generation of particles during hot melting, the inner wall of the hot melting box 6 is rotatably connected with a stirring column 8, one end of the stirring column 8 is fixedly connected with a second motor 9, the lower surface of the guide pipe 2 is fixedly connected with a discharge hole 10, the bottom of the discharge hole 10 is provided with a chute, the inside of the chute is slidably connected with a sliding plate 11, the sliding plate 11 slides in the chute, the size of the outlet at the bottom of the discharge hole 10 is adjusted, an expansion plate 14 is expanded, extruded materials are cut off as required, thereby achieving the effect of adjusting the length and the width of the PC board, one side of the support plate 1 is fixedly connected with a support rod 12, the lower surface of the support rod 12 is fixedly connected with a support column 16, the inside of the support column 16 is provided with a round hole, the inside of the round hole is fixedly connected with, the outer surface of conveyer belt 19 has seted up anti-skidding groove, and one side of bracing piece 12 is rotated and is connected with extrusion column 13, and the outer fixed surface of backup pad 1 is connected with expansion plate 14, and the one end fixed connection of expansion plate 14 has cutting piece 15.
The utility model discloses in, push-and-pull protective door 20 moves on the slip table and can open or close the device, thereby certain guard action has been reached, second motor 9 rotates and drives stirring post 8 and rotate, the material gets into hot-melt case 6 back, hot melt while stirring, the good material of hot melt flows down through filter screen 7, the granule is blocked by filter screen 7 and continues the hot melt, thereby the production of particulate matter when having prevented the hot melt, first motor 4 drives hob 3 and rotates, make the good material of hot melt extrude from discharge gate 10, sliding plate 11 slides in the spout, adjustment discharge gate 10 bottom export size, expansion plate 14 stretches out and cuts off the good material of extrusion as required, thereby can reach the effect of adjusting PC board length and width.
